In this paper, we study the performance of large-scale MIMO network where the base station has a large number of antennas and performs semi-blind channel estimation. We show that one can increase the number of antennas at the user side without increasing the overhead imposed by the channel estimation linearly with the number of user antennas. Specifically, we propose a simple data-aided channel estimation scheme which exploits the quasi-orthogonality of the channel vectors and takes advantage of the conventional pilot-aided channel estimation performed for the first antenna at each user. Two schemes are then analyzed using the extra antenna(s) at the users: data-multiplexing and interference alignment. We obtain achievable rates for the proposed uplink multi-cell MIMO system in both schemes. The rate bounds are tight and the system performance is also analyzed in terms of the outage probability to study the effect of the data length used for channel estimation scheme.
